Solving Quadratic Equations by Completing the Square

The Completing-the-Square Method:
1. Convert x2 + 6x - 4 = 0 to
x2 + 6x = 4
2. Convert x2 + 6x to a perfect square by adding a term:

3. Keep the equation balanced by adding the same term to the right-hand side:

4. Rewrite as a square and use the Square-Root method:
(x + 3)2 = 4 + 9 = 13
and solve.
